Change Your Oil

Oil plays a crucial role in the everyday function of your Jeep Wrangler in West Allis. Oil cools, cleans, and lubricates the engine, and needs to be replaced regularly. You can find out how often your vehicle's oil needs to be changed by checking the owner's manual. For optimal winter performance, don't miss your winter oil change interval.

Install Snow Tires

Wet, icy roads can add a lot of stress to driving your Dodge Durango in Franklin. To improve traction while driving in wintry conditions, you can install snow tires. Snow tires have deeper treads and are made from softer rubber than all-season tires. Snow tires can provide peace of mind to your winter commutes.

Install Winter Wiper Blades

Regular windshield wipers can struggle to keep your windshield clear of ice and snow. Winter wiper blades are made from stiffer rubber than regular wiper blades. This means they are better at scraping away ice and snow and are more durable.
